Keep it safe!
We don't like thinking about it but
it's a fact of life that car thieves
operate in rural areas and we have contacted
by one walker who was an unfortunate
victim recently. So make sure that you
follow our quick guide to protect your
car and valuables so it doesn't happen
to you.
|
|
Lock it - Always lock your
car including sunroofs and windows,
don't leave them an invitation
Remove it - Take your possessions
with you and don't leave valuables in
your glove box
Hide it - Never leave anything
on view. If you can't take your possessions
with you them by locking them in the
boot

Looking for Short walks in Swindon?
Tara's Trails was started when we found it almost
impossible to find walks in and around Swindon that weren't
half day or whole day treks. We are building up a website of
short walks that can be completed in about 2 hours and less
than 3.5 miles. So don't worry if you are not a rambler these
walks should be suitable for that Sunday afternoon stroll.
